FAQs about Red Roof Inn Crestview

Is parking available at the property?

Free self-parking is available on-site.


What type of breakfast is offered and what are the serving hours?

A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 6:00 AM to 9:00 AM.


Are pets allowed at the property?

Pets are allowed, with no charge for one pet. A fee of USD 15 per pet, per night applies for two or more pets. Service animals are exempt from fees.


What are the standard check-in and check-out times?

Check-in is from 3:00 PM, and check-out is at 11:00 AM. Late check-out is available for a fee, subject to availability.

What accessibility features are available for guests with disabilities?

The property features elevators and step-free entrances, along with wheelchair-accessible facilities in public areas and rooms.


Where is the property located in relation to key landmarks?

The property is located in the heart of Crestview, within a 5-minute drive of Redstone Plaza and Crestview Commons. It is approximately 30.1 miles from Miramar Beach and 31.7 miles from Destin Beaches.


What are the policies for guests staying with children?

One child 17 years old or younger stays free when occupying the parent or guardian's room, using existing bedding.
